Concrete foundation repair services involve assessing and restoring the structural integrity of a building’s foundation. These services typically include identifying issues such as cracks, settling, or shifting, and implementing solutions to stabilize and reinforce the foundation. Techniques may involve underpinning, piering, or slab jacking to lift and level the concrete, preventing further movement and damage. The goal is to ensure the foundation remains solid and secure, supporting the overall stability of the property.
These repair services address common problems caused by soil movement, moisture changes, or poor initial construction. Foundation issues often manifest as uneven floors, cracked walls, or sticking doors and windows. If left unaddressed, these problems can lead to more extensive structural damage, costly repairs, or safety hazards. Foundation repair helps mitigate these risks by correcting underlying issues and preventing future deterioration, thereby preserving the property’s value and safety.

The overview below groups typical Concrete Foundation Repair proj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Charleston, IL.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Cost Range for Repair - The typical cost for concrete foundation repair varies widely, generally falling between $2,000 and $7,000. Minor crack repairs may cost around $1,000, while extensive foundation stabilization can exceed $10,000 depending on the scope.
Factors Influencing Costs - Prices depend on the extent of damage, foundation size, and repair methods used. For example, a small crack repair in Charleston, IL might be around $1,500, whereas full foundation underpinning could reach $15,000 or more.
Average Project Expenses - Most homeowners spend approximately $3,500 to $9,000 for foundation repair services. Costs can be lower for simple crack sealing and higher for major structural repairs involving soil stabilization.
Cost Variability - The actual cost varies based on factors like accessibility and foundation type. Local service providers can provide detailed estimates tailored to specific foundation conditions and property sizes.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

How do I know if my concrete foundation needs repairs? Signs such as visible cracks, uneven floors, or doors and windows that stick may indicate foundation issues. Consulting with a local foundation repair specialist can help assess the condition of the foundation.
What types of foundation repair services are available? Common services include crack repair, underpinning, leveling, and stabilization. Local service providers can recommend the appropriate solutions based on the specific foundation concerns.
How long does concrete foundation repair typically take? The duration varies depending on the extent of damage and the repair method used. A consultation with a local contractor can provide a more accurate timeframe for specific repairs.
Are there preventative measures to avoid foundation problems? Proper drainage, soil stabilization, and regular inspections can help prevent foundation issues. Local pros can advise on maintenance strategies suitable for the area.
